What are the procedures for adoption in Mexico?

Adoption in Mexico involves a legal process that seeks to ensure the well-being of minors. Typical steps include the application for adoption before the National System for the Comprehensive Development of the Family (DIF) or an authorized institution, the evaluation of the suitability of the adopters, the assignment of a minor, the authorization of the family judge, and finally , the formalization of the adoption in a court. The process seeks to ensure that adopters are capable of providing an appropriate environment for the minor.

What impact does identity validation have on the prevention of identity theft in voting processes and elections in Mexico?

Identity validation has a significant impact on preventing identity theft in voting and election processes in Mexico. Voters must present official identification, such as their voter ID card (INE), when going to the polls. This ensures that only registered and legitimate citizens have the right to vote. Additionally, electoral authorities can verify the identity of voters and prevent duplicate votes. Identity validation is essential to maintain the integrity of the electoral process and ensure democratic representation in Mexico.
